Determines inverter capacity to handle peak loads from solar or battery systems. Prevents inadequate power and equipment damage.

Steg-för-steg-guide

  1. 1Sum peak simultaneous power consumption (watts)
  2. 2Account for inrush current (motors 3-5× running)
  3. 3Add 25-50% capacity headroom for growth
  4. 4Select inverter rated 120-150% of peak load

Vanliga misstag att undvika

  • Using average power instead of peak power
  • Not accounting for motor inrush current

Vanliga frågor

What happens if inverter is undersized?

Insufficient power for peak loads, brownouts, equipment damage, and automatic shutoff.

What if inverter is oversized?

Wastes money; minor efficiency loss; better to slightly oversize than undersized.
